WebThey are also found in official imperial depictions of the Neo-Assyrian reliefs; of particular note are the wall panels of Ashurnasirpal II (r. 884–859 bce), where the king is in a chariot, turning his head backward to face a lion charging from behind ;62 or of Ashurbanipal (r. 668–631 bce) hunting lions from his chariot (Figure 3 and Figure 4).63 The horse … WebAshurbanipal (Neo-Assyrian cuneiform: Aššur-bāni-apli, meaning "Ashur is the creator of the heir") was the king of the Neo-Assyrian Empire from 669 BCE to his death in 631. He is generally remembered as the last great king of Assyria.
